I have always found joy in capturing the beauty of nature. When I first started using colored pencils, my focus was primarily on botanical subjects: mushrooms, fruits, and medicinal plants.
Recently, I felt a strong desire to revisit these themes. It was the sight of two tangerines resting on crumpled paper that reminded me of classical Still Lifes, which I have always adored.
By chance, I stumbled upon a tree enveloped in ivy. I spent roughly two hours taking photographs until I finally captured the perfect shot, one that exuded freshness and tranquility. It was in Bulgaria, four years ago that I began working on this piece, meticulously studying the intricate textures of the tree and the ivy leaves. Unfortunately, due to other commitments, progress on the artwork was slow. However, during the Covid-19 lockdown, I finally found the necessary time to bring it to completion. I am incredibly pleased with the final result."
